JOB TITLE: Multimedia Marketing Specialist

REPORTS TO: Marketing Manager

DEPARTMENT: Marketing

STATUS: Exempt

Job Summary

The primary responsibility of this position is to "tell our story" and promote digital equity within the Gila River Indian Community. The ideal candidate will possess excellent communication skills, be detail‑oriented, have a deep understanding of traditional Native American culture, and stay updated on current pop culture trends. The incumbent will be responsible for creating and managing engaging content, video production, social media management, marketing events, public relations, writing blog posts, and scriptwriting.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Create and curate engaging and informative content that highlights the mission and initiatives of GRTI and its subsidiary companies.
  • Create visually appealing and impactful multimedia content, including infographics, videos, and visual explainers.
  • Develop and maintain a content calendar to ensure regular updates across various digital platforms (website, social media, blog, newsletter, posters, flyers, SMS notices, etc.).
  • Manage and optimize the company’s website and social media channels, including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, LinkedIn, and YouTube.
  • Monitor social media trends and implement appropriate strategies to increase engagement and followership.
  • Produce and edit short videos to support digital campaigns and promotional material.
  • Write scripts for video content that effectively conveys the desired message.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to gather information, stories, and updates to create relevant and captivating content.
  • Occasionally produce high‑quality written articles, blog posts, and press releases that effectively communicate our message to the target audience.
  • Develop and maintain relationships with media outlets, journalists, and key stakeholders to ensure positive coverage and promotion of GRTI and subsidiaries.
  • Stay abreast of industry trends and best practices in content creation, social media management, and digital marketing.
  • Assist in the planning, promotion, and execution of events organized by GRTI and subsidiaries.
  • Manage time effectively to meet deadlines and prioritize tasks accordingly.

Skills and Competencies

  • Advanced graphic design skills.
  • Strong storytelling skills with exceptional written and verbal communication abilities.
  • Passionate about digital equity and promoting inclusiveness within Indigenous communities.
  • Familiarity with traditional Native American culture, customs, and values.
  • Knowledge of current pop culture trends and the ability to incorporate them into content strategies effectively.
  • Proficient in using social media management tools and platforms.
  • Video production skills and experience with video editing software (e.g., Adobe Premiere Pro, Final Cut Pro, etc.).
  • Excellent organizational skills with the ability to multitask and manage time effectively.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to delivering high‑quality work.
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a team‑oriented environment.
  • An understanding of PR principles and experience in public relations is a plus.
  • Clear, strong verbal communication and consulting skills. Demonstrated ability to work at the senior leadership level. The ideal candidate will have a positive attitude and be a problem‑solver.
  • Ability to physically stand, bend, squat, and lift up to 25 to 30 pounds.
  • Maintain strict confidentiality guidelines in accordance with company policy.
  • Ensure GRTI Employee Handbook is understood and followed in a consistent and respectful manner.

Education and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in web design, Communications, Marketing, Journalism, or a related field. Equivalent experience will be considered.
  • Proven experience in content creation, social media management, and/or digital marketing.
